JUSTICE SANJAY KUMAR ORAL ORDER 08-02-2017 Heard learned counsel for the petitioner and learned APP appearing on behalf of the State.
The petitioner seeks regular bail in connection with Case No. C/7-376 of 2016 registered for the offence punishable under Section 30(a) of the Bihar Prohibition and Excise Act, 2016.
The allegation against this petitioner is that he was apprehended by the Excise Inspector and 17 bottles of foreign liquor was recovered from his vehicle.
Learned counsel for the petitioner submits that the petitioner has falsely been implicated by the police. There is absolutely no recovery from his conscious possession and there is no antecedent against this petitioner. The petitioner is in
Patna High Court Cr.Misc. No.5845 of 2017 (2) dt.08-02-2017 2/2 custody since 12.12.2016.
Learned APP for the State opposed the submission. Considering the nature of allegation and the facts and circumstances stated above, the prayer for bail application is allowed. The petitioner, Munna Kumar Singh, is directed to be enlarged on bail on furnishing bail bonds of Rs. 10,000/- (ten thousand) with two sureties of the each amount to the satisfaction of the learned Chief Judicial Magistrate, Banka in connection with case No. C/7-376 of 2016.
